Effects of Dietary Energy Level on Nutrients Apparent Digestibility and Blood Biochemical Indices of Dairy Cows under Heat Stress
摘要
Abstract
In order to investigate the effects of dietary energy level on milk production, nutrients apparent di-gestibility and blood biochemical indices of dairy cows under heat stress, a single factor experimental design was used. Twenty-five healthy Chinese Holstein dairy cows in mid-lactation were allocated to 5 groups ( 5 cows in each group) corresponding to 5 isonitrogenous dietary treatments with net energy levels [ net energy for lac-tation (NEL), dry matter basis] of 6.15 (group 1), 6.36 (group 2), 6.64 (group 3), 6.95 (group 4) and 7.36 MJ/kg ( group 5) , respectively. The experiment lasted for 45 days, including a 15-day pre-experimental period followed by a 30-day experimental period. The results showed as follows: 1) the improving of dietary energy level reduced respiratory frequency, groups 4 and 5 were extremely significantly lower than groups 1 and 2 ( P<0.01) , and had no significant difference compared with group 3 ( P>0.05) . 2) There was a signifi-cant negative correlation between dry matter intake and dietary energy level (R2=0.983 3, P=0.017), and group 5 was significantly lower than the other groups (P<0.05 or P<0.01); milk yield in group 4 was the highest, and was increased by 9% compared with that in group 1 ( group 1 had the lowest value) , the differ-ence was extramely significant ( P<0.01) . 3) Apparent digestibility of nutrients ( excepted calcium, phosphor-us and gross energy) reached the maximum in group 1 and the minimum in group 5, the differences were sig-nificant or extramely significant ( P<0.05 or P<0.01) . 4) In group 4, serum cortisol concentration was signifi-cantly or extramely significantly lower than that in groups 1, 2 and 5 (P<0.05 or P<0.01), serum lipopo-lysaccharide concentration was significantly or extramely significantly lower than that in the other groups ( P<0.05 or P<0.01) , and serum glucose concentration was significantly higher than that in groups 1 and 5 ( P<0.05); the activity of serum creatine kinase in groups 1 and 4 was significantly or extramely significantly high-er than that in groups 2, 3 and 5 ( P<0.05 or P<0.01) , and group 4 increased by 32.87% and 25.40% com-pared with groups 2 and 3, respectively; the activities of serum cereal third transaminase and aspertate amin-otransferase showed group 1>group 2>group 4>group 3>group 5. Comprehensive analysis on the effects of di-etary energy level on milk production, nutrients apparent digestibility and blood biochemical indices indicates that under conditions in the present study, the optimal dietary NEL level is 6. 95 MJ/kg of dairy cows under heat stress.关键词
